Core Concepts and Principles
Effective video prompting operates on several foundational principles that many creators overlook in their rush to produce content. The most critical concept involves semantic precision – the ability to construct prompts that communicate specific visual intentions without ambiguity. This requires understanding how different prompt components interact and influence the final output. The hierarchy of prompt elements follows a specific order of importance: primary subject, environmental context, lighting conditions, camera movement, and stylistic modifiers. When troubleshooting poor results, I consistently find that creators have either omitted crucial elements or arranged them in ways that create conflicting instructions.- Subject clarity must be established before adding environmental details
- Lighting descriptions should precede camera movement specifications
- Style modifiers work best when applied after technical parameters are defined
- Temporal elements require specific positioning to avoid confusion

Best Practices for Success
After troubleshooting hundreds of failed prompt attempts, I’ve identified several critical success factors that consistently produce superior results. The most important involves progressive refinement – starting with basic prompts and systematically adding complexity rather than attempting comprehensive descriptions initially. Successful professionals employ a structured approach to prompt development. Begin with core subject identification, then layer environmental context, followed by technical specifications. This methodology prevents the common mistake of overwhelming the system with contradictory instructions.- Test individual prompt components before combining them
- Maintain consistent terminology throughout your prompt sequences
- Document successful prompt patterns for future reference
- Establish baseline parameters before experimenting with variations

Essential Features Overview
Modern prompt builders offer extensive feature sets, but understanding which capabilities provide genuine value versus marketing novelty requires practical experience. The most essential features center around prompt templating systems that enable rapid customization while maintaining proven structural foundations. Version control capabilities prove indispensable for professional workflows. The ability to track prompt iterations, compare results, and revert to previous versions prevents countless hours of reconstruction work when experiments fail. Advanced users leverage branching systems that enable parallel development of different creative directions. Real-time preview functionality, while appealing in concept, often creates false expectations about final output quality. Professional implementations treat previews as rough approximations rather than definitive representations, avoiding the disappointment that leads many creators to abandon otherwise effective prompt strategies.Integration and Workflow Optimization
